1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you punctuate the titles of books?
Back
You should underline or italicize the titles of books.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you punctuate the titles of newspaper articles?
Back
You should use quotation marks for the titles of newspaper articles.

4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you punctuate the titles of movies?
Back
You should underline or italicize the titles of movies.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you punctuate the titles of songs?
Back
You should use quotation marks for the titles of songs.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the rule for punctuating titles of magazines?
Back
You should underline or italicize the titles of magazines.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you punctuate the titles of plays?
Back
You should underline or italicize the titles of plays.
